Variable Size Regions! Support for prehash RegionSizeX and large patches. (WIP)
Mostly from Ukando, tweaked a bit to be cleaner, and a little less dramatic. decode_patch_header now takes a bool optionally, as third argument. _PREHASH_RegionSizeX is the only used of the two _PREHASH_RegionSize*. llsurface.cpp: Copy the connectNeighbor for variable size regions almost directly from Ukando llsurfacepatch.cpp: Patch code from ukando and voodoo. Changed hardcoded 256 constants and such to width functions in: llglsandbox.cpp, llsurface.cpp, llviewerregion.cpp, llviewerparcelmanager, llviewerparcelmgr.cpp, llvowater.cpp, llworld.cpp Use region specific width in: llagent.cpp, llglsandbox.cpp, llmanip.cpp, llmanipscale.cpp, llpanelobject.cpp, llviewerbject.cpp, llwind.cpp Use 256 in llnetmap.cpp in places... llfloaterregioninfo.cpp: Aurora grid has wacky textures. Add LLViewerParcelMgr::widthUpdate() for updating mParcelsPerEdge given a region's width. Used in llstartup now. Add LLWorld::setWidth() for getting a region's size from LLMessageSystem pointers and setting mWidth and mWidthInMeters, accordingly. Called in llviewermessage.cpp as well.
